
Nobody’s perfect
2006
Feature Film
Synopsis
Ruben is deaf, and what he likes most in the world are women and his friends. Carlos is blind, and what he likes most in the world is the movies, his guide-dog Woody and his friends. Dani is lame, and what he likes most in the world is his car Blanquito, provoking people, and his friends. Carlos is getting married his life-long girlfriend. The boys want to celebrate the night before the wedding with a full-blown stag night. So they spruce themselves up, pile into Danny’s “buggy” and set off to the beat of the latest summer hit on an adventure that will change the course of their lives. On this night to remember, each will see a dream come true. Ruben meets a girl in red who can’t distinguish flavours, and he finally dares to sing. Carlos meets a lost soul who’s hung-up on her ex boyfriend, and finally dares to drive. And Dani meets a belligerent graffiti artist and finally dares to dance.
Additional Information
Coproduced with Pentagrama Films and MediaPro. 200-print Spanish release in October 2006 with a total 512,000 viewers. 7th most-seen Spanish film of 2006.
